The Integrated Model of Workplace Mental Health - with Tony LaMontagne
In this episode we chat with Tony LaMontagne, Professor of Work, Health & Wellbeing at Deakin University. Tony shares insights from his research, explains why a model or framework is an important foundation for a psych health and safety strategy, and discusses the differences between his integrated model of psychological health and safety, the public health model, and the thrive at work model. He shares practical examples of how his model has been applied, provides advice for organisations developing their psych health and safety strategies, and a whole lot more in this extra-long episode!
